Brothers Mark and Adam Kassen direct this dramatic film based on the true story of two lawyers who take on a huge corporation.

Starring: Chris Evans and Mark Kassen [full cast list under the ‘Cast’ tab]
Directed By: Adam and Mark Kassen
Writer: Chris Lopata
Release Date: September 23, 2011
Running Time: 99 minutes
Genre: Drama
MPAA Rating: R for drug use, language, some nudity and a sexual reference

Official Synopsis: Mike Weiss (Chris Evans) is a talented young Houston lawyer and a functioning drug addict. Paul Danziger (co-director Mark Kassen), his longtime friend and partner, is the straightlaced and responsible yin to Mike’s yang. Their mom-and-pop personal-injury law firm is getting by, but things really get interesting when they decide to take on a case involving Vicky (Vinessa Shaw), a local ER nurse, who is pricked by a contaminated needle on the job. As Weiss and Danziger dig deeper into the case, a health care and pharmaceutical conspiracy teeters on exposure and heavyweight attorneys move in on the defense. Out of their league but invested in their own principles, the mounting pressure of the case pushes the two underdog lawyers and their business to the breaking point.
